CLASS I-V     18 miles
  This stretch of Cathance Stream is 18 miles long and is a class I-V section of whitewater according to American Whitewater. Briefly about the general area:
All through the summertime at Cathance Stream temperatures are ordinarily in the 80's while night lows are ordinarily in the 50's. For the period of the winter highs are in the 20's, and during the dark hours in the wintertime at Cathance Stream temperatures fall to the 0's. Lots of precipitation falls at Cathance Stream; November is the
 
wettest month with most rain, and the driest of the months is July.
